Bonuses: Bigger, But Read the Fine Print

Welcome offers at these casinos are typically larger than UK equivalents – deposit matches with free spins, no deposit bonuses, reloads, cashback, and loyalty programmes are all common. But the terms matter more than the headline number.

Before you hit “claim,” check these conditions:

  1. Wagering requirements – how many times you need to play through the bonus before withdrawing
  2. Eligible games – not all slots or table games contribute equally
  3. Maximum bet limits – betting too much per spin can void the bonus
  4. Maximum withdrawal limits – some no deposit offers cap what you can cash out
  5. Payment restrictions – certain deposit methods may disqualify you from the bonus

No deposit bonuses are especially popular: free spins or small cash amounts with no upfront deposit. They often come with stricter withdrawal caps, so treat them as a test drive rather than a payout strategy.
